DaphniConsidering his hectic touring schedule, it’s quite surprising to see a new LP by Dan Snaith, known to most as Caribou.

The Canadian producer has resurrected his Daphni alias and dropped a nine track album titled Jialong. His first full length under the Daphni moniker sees him take a somewhat different direction that most Caribou fans are used to, exploring familiar dance floor rhythms and murky analog textures.

His own words ‘I’d fallen back in love with moments in small, dark clubs when a DJ puts on a piece of music that not only can you not identify but that until you heard it, you could not have conceived of it existing’ do a fantastic job in really summing up what this LP is. Sounds seem to come out of nowhere, but at the same time, retain a sense of familiarity from what you’ve heard before.

A really great debut from an amazing producer.
